Trade Idea: 2010-08-26 1:31
I don't usually go for day trades, but this setup on NZDUSD has got my sweet-tooth tingling! It seems like the pair is testing the falling trend line on the 15-minute chart again. I think I'll side with the bears on this one since stochastics is well within overbuying territory.
Price is also making lower highs while stochastics is making higher highs. You know what that means... A bearish divergence! And to top it all off like a cherry on a sundae, a doji recently formed!
For now, it seems like the bias for this pair is still downwards, thanks to ongoing risk aversion. Just yesterday, the US printed out a couple of disappointing figures, namely the durable goods orders and new home sales. Both reports came in much worse than expected, suggesting that fears of a double-dip recession might actually be realized. Yikes!
Anyway, I just couldn't let this trade slip away so I jumped in at market. Here are the details of this day trade:
Short NZDUSD at market (.7033), stop loss at .7080, pt at .6940.
Since I still have an AUDUSD short open, I'm only risking 0.5% of my account, which is half my usual risk, on this one. Wish me luck!
